Analysis of factors contributing to the sustained decline in U.S. violent crime rates
Axios·US·1 day ago
The US is experiencing a sharp, historically significant decline in crime rates, though the precise drivers remain uncertain. Researchers suggest a confluence of factors, including post-pandemic shifts in substance use, increased adoption of AI-driven policing tools, demographic aging, and changes in prosecutorial strategy.
